What Are Dry Storage Containers?
Dry storage containers are big, standardized Shipping Container Housing containers developed to save non-perishable products. These containers are normally made of corrugated steel, making them durable and weather-resistant. They are offered in various sizes, with the most common being 20-foot and 40-foot containers. These containers are especially popular among companies for their capability to help with the storage and transport of products around the world.

Maintenance Tips for Dry Storage Containers
To make sure durability and continued functionality of dry storage containers, routine maintenance is necessary. Here are essential maintenance suggestions:
Regular Inspections: Check for rust, structural integrity, and seal conditions to prevent leakages.
Tidy and Organize: Maintain cleanliness and company inside the container to prevent pest problems.
Protect Locks: Regularly inspect and lubricate the locking systems to keep them operating properly.
Positioning: Ensure the container is positioned on steady ground to prevent shifting or sinking.

Q2: Can dry storage containers be customized?A2: Yes, numerous suppliers offer customization options, including additional doors, ventilation, shelving, and even refrigeration for temperature-sensitive items.
Q3: Are dry storage containers waterproof?A3: While they are weather-resistant, they are not entirely waterproof. For that reason, it is advisable to utilize wetness absorbers for delicate products. Q4: How do I transport a dry storage container?A4: Transportation can generally be accomplished by flatbed trucks or High Cube Shipping Containers trailers, however it's finest to employ specialists experienced in managing containers.
